1、进入存放自己项目war的目录
编辑Dockerfile文件
vim Dockerfile
内容如下:
rom registry.docker-cn.com/library/tomcatMAINTAINER heihezi heihezi@foxmail.comCOPY myproject.war /usr/local/tomcat/webapps
2、build自己的镜像
docker build -t myproject:latest .
不出意外的会显示build镜像的步骤,最后一行为
Successfully built b3f6ac3157ae
最后的字符串是镜像id的一部分。
此时可以运行docker images查看自己的镜像信息
3、运行自己的docker容器
docker run -d -p 8888:8080 myproject
这里 -d 是后台运行,-p 是指定端口,后面的 8888:8080 是映射宿主机的8888端口到docker的8080端口,这时如果运行成功会打印出一个id
4、访问自己的项目
查看tomcat是否启动成功
192.168.1.178:8888
访问项目(加项目名)
192.168.1.178:8888/myproject
到此这篇关于docker运行项目的方法的文章就介绍到这了,更多相关docker如何运行项目内容请搜索优爱好网以前的文章或继续浏览下面的相关文章希望大家以后多多支持优爱好网!
相关文章:
1. 深入理解JavaScript中的Base64编码字符串2. 怎样才能用js生成xmldom对象,并且在firefox中也实现xml数据岛?3. 浅谈docker compose书写规则4. Thinkphp3.2.3反序列化漏洞实例分析5. JavaScript深拷贝方法structuredClone使用6. Docker跨主机容器通信overlay实现过程详解7. Email+URL的判断和自动转换函数8. uniapp自定义验证码输入框并隐藏光标9. 详解JavaScript中原始数据类型Symbol的使用10. 使用Node.js实现Clean Architecture方法示例详解